Property Tax Deadline is Oct. 15
One week remains to pay real estate and personal property taxes without penalty. Due to Covid-19 restrictions, only two customers are allowed in the office at a time, so be prepared to wait longer if paying in person. There is a dropbox located outside the office door if you would like to put your tax payment in it and a receipt will be mailed. Payments may also be mailed to 507 Church Ave or online at tax.countyservice.net.
The Mena Art Gallery will be open extended hours during October to give people a chance to see the national Art of the Heartland Show. October hours are: Friday, Oct. 16, 3 pm – 7 pm; Saturday, Oct. 17, 3pm – 7 pm; Sunday, Oct. 18, Noon – 3 pm; Friday, Oct. 23, 3 pm – 7 pm; Saturday, Oct. 24, 3 pm – 7 pm; Sunday, Oct. 25, Noon – 3 pm. For more information contact Mena Art Gallery, 607 Mena Street, at 479-394-3880.
